City Council meeting of September 18, 2000 <br />Page 7 <br />BID AWARD FOR CONSTRUCTION OF WELL #3 <br />The Council authorized plans and specs to be prepared by the City Engineer for the construction of <br />well #3, and authorized that the project go out for bid. The City Engineer opened bids on September <br />15, 2000, with the following results: Traut Wells, Inc. ($82,240), and Key Well Drilling ($95,762). <br />Barnes made motion, Leroux seconded, to accept the City Engineer's recommendation and award the <br />bids for construction of well #3 to Traut Wells, Inc., in the amount of $82,240. <br />All aye. Motion Carried. <br />EXECUTIVE SESSION <br />Leroux made motion, Barnes seconded, to go into executive session at 10:15 pm, to include property owners <br />named as plaintiffs, for the purpose of discussion of JD2 litigation. <br />All aye.
